Simile Definition
A simile is a figure of speech that directly compares two different things.
The simile is usually in a phrase that begins with the words "as" or "like."
3
A Simile is NOT a METAPHOR
A simile is different from a metaphor, which is also a comparison.
But a metaphor does not use 'like' or 'as'
Metaphor will have 'is' or 'was' or 'were' to compare two nouns.
4
Simile Examples
The rain pelted us like rocks.
The rain is being compared to rocks. This means the rain was HARD.
The boy ran as fast as a cheetah.
The boy is being compared to a cheetah. This means he is FAST.
5
Metaphor Example
The baby is an angel.
The baby is being compared to an angel. This means the baby does not do anything wrong.
The teacher was an early worm to school everyday.
This is comparing the teacher to an early worm. This means the teacher gets to school early every day.
